2016年1月25日--ARM表示OpenSynergy公司正在为其最先进的实时安全处理器ARM® Cortex®-R52 开发业界第一款软件管理程序。该管理程序可将任何基于Cortex-R52的芯片变为虚拟机,并能同时执行不同的软件任务。针对诸如无人驾驶和工业控制系统等设备中芯片不断提升的复杂性,该方法可以将安全性至关重要的功能与无需严格控制的功能相隔离。此外,它能够将应用程序整合到更少的电子控制单元(ECU),以便管理复杂性并降低成本。
ARM嵌入式营销副总裁Richard York表示:“面向大众市场的无人汽车将被赋予大幅增强的ECU计算能力和安全管理更复杂软件栈的能力。为此,Cortex-R52应运而生,借助管理程序实现软件隔离,从而保护重要的安全功能,并同时确保任务的快速执行。这样对于高性能车,我们将能放心地把驾驶任务交给自动驾驶系统。”
OpenSynergy首席执行官Stefaan Sonck Thiebaut表示:“Cortex-R52将虚拟化技术可应用于更广泛的汽车设备。对此,我们非常期待为下一代汽车架构提供支持。”
Cortex-R52不仅将硬件的虚拟化支持导入Cortex-R处理器系列,还维持硬实时操作系统(hard real-time systems)的所有必要功能。在虚拟机中维持绝对执行性的特色,对于协助各式机器人相关应用同时运行多个实时操作系统所面临的挑战,提供了最佳解决方案。
OpenSynergy软件架构适用于诸如域控制器(domain controllers)之类的微控制器。虚拟机管理程序技术支持多个实时操作系统和不同ASIL级别的AUTOSAR系统在ARM Cortex-R52上的同时运行。
关于ARM
作为计算和互联革命的核心,ARM技术正改变着人们生活和企业运行的方式。从不可或缺的领域到无形支持, ARM先进的高能效处理器设计已应用于超过860亿芯片,安全地为电子设备提供支持,覆盖从传感器到智能手机乃至超级计算的多种应用。ARM拥有超过1,000家技术合作伙伴,包括世界上最著名的商业和消费品牌。ARM正积极地开展合作,期望能将ARM创新应用到所有需要计算的领域,包括芯片,网络和云。